The Battle of Peleliu was code-named Stalemate II, a name that seems ironic in hindsight, because in the beginning the campaign was seen with relative optimism. The primary task of securing the island was supplied to the 1st Marine Division, a mostly veteran device that had witnessed motion at Guadalcanal and New Britain.

The assault about the pillbox made up of the 47mm gun was led by Lieutenant William Willis. Whilst his riflemen saved up a steady covering hearth, Willis dashed to the top on the pillbox and tossed a smoke grenade before the aperture to blind the Japanese defenders. One more Marine scored a immediate strike using a rifle grenade which detonated In the pillbox, setting up a massive explosion and fire inside the construction.

Whilst the 1st Marines slugged it out from the Umurborgol, battling ongoing elsewhere. Through several days of fierce fight, the 7th Marines mopped up remaining Japanese resistance south in the landing shorelines, and afterwards captured two tiny islands located off the coast. In the meantime, the Army’s 81st Division executed an amphibious landing within the island of Anguar on September 17.
